TASTING NOTES

Les Cretes is identified in the Valdostan landscape for the constant search for quality in the work in the vineyard, with particular attention to the terroir and characteristics of the grapes, then enhanced in the bottle. Pinot Noir Valle d'Aosta PDO is a 100% Pinot Noir, in which the grapes are de-stemmed and cryomacerated for 2 days. Then follows alcoholic fermentation in stainless steel at a controlled and constant temperature with daily pumping over. Aging in stainless steel for 6 months. The glass is deep ruby red, with fruity notes of red berries, with notes of sage. The palate is juicy and slightly savory, with fine structure and velvety tannins.
